About the Role We are seeking an experienced Instructional Training Designer to join our IVL Federal Medical Insurance Learning and Execution group. As a key member of our team, you will have the opportunity to work on large-scale projects and develop training programs that drive business results. This is a remote-based position that requires a strong and diverse skillset in areas such as instructional design, adult learning theory, and project management. Key Responsibilities Design and develop engaging and effective learning experiences that meet the needs of our customers and stakeholders Work with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to identify training needs and develop solutions that address those needs Develop informative objectives and create content that meets those objectives Design educational materials, such as infographics, and develop supporting materials, such as audio, video, and simulations Develop methods of evaluation, such as tests and quizzes, to measure the effectiveness of training programs Assess evaluations and provide results and recommendations for improvement Essential Qualifications To be successful in this role, you will need to have the following qualifications: Bachelor's degree in a relevant field, such as instructional design, education, or communications At least 2 years of experience in corporate learning program development and implementation Ability to travel up to 40% of the time Preferred Qualifications In addition to the essential qualifications, we are looking for candidates who have the following preferred qualifications: Project management and leadership experience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to communicate effectively with all levels of the organization Meticulous attention to detail and a quality-focused attitude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and prioritize tasks effectively Experience working in a matrixed organization and collaborating with cross-functional teams Proficiency in Microsoft Office, including SharePoint, Articulate, Dazzle, Vyond, and case management systems Skills and Competencies To be successful in this role, you will need to possess the following skills and competencies: Strong instructional design skills, with the ability to design and develop engaging and effective learning experiences Excellent project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and prioritize tasks effectively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to communicate effectively with all levels of the organization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t to changing priorities and deadlines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to analyze data and develop recommendations for improvement Career Growth Opportunities and Learning Benefits Aetna is committed to the growth and development of our employees.
